Nurse Practitioner (Hematology / Oncology)
The Registered Nurse Practitioner - NP (Hematology / Oncology) is an advanced practice nurse working independently, collectively and collaboratively within an interdisciplinary team. The NP collaborates with other disciplines to develop, implement, and coordinate a system of patient care delivery that promotes communication, teamwork, high quality care, patient satisfaction, positive outcomes, appropriate utilization of resources and cost-effective services. Basic Requirements: United States Citizenship English Language Proficiency. Education. A post-master's certificate or master's or doctoral degree as a APNs (NPs).
